html5,video标签,属性

HTML5视频标签(

1. src

该属性指定了要嵌入的视频的URL。可以将本地文件或网络视频链接作为该属性的值。

2. controls

该属性表示是否要显示控制条。如果设置为「controls」,则会在视频下方显示媒体控制栏,包括播放、暂停、音量、全屏等按钮。

3. autoplay

如果将该属性设置为「autoplay」,则视频在页面加载时会自动开始播放。需要注意的是,在某些浏览器(比如Safari)中,该属性默认被禁用,需手动授权。

4. loop

如果将该属性设置为「loop」,则视频会循环播放。

5. muted

该属性将视频静音。设置为「muted」后,将没有任何声音。

6. poster

该属性允许设置视频的封面图片。如果没有设置该属性,将使用默认的黑色背景。

7. height/width

这两个属性分别代表视频的高度和宽度。如果不设置,则浏览器将根据视频大小自动调整。

8. preload

该属性指定了视频的预加载行为。可以有三个值:

- none: 表示视频不会被预加载

- metadata: 表示只加载视频的metadata(比如宽度、高度、时长等)

- auto: 表示视频将在页面加载时预加载

9. currentTime

该属性允许开发人员脚本控制视频的当前播放时间。比如,视频可以从指定时间开始播放。

10. volume

该属性用于设置视频的音量。

11. controlsList

该属性设置控制栏中要显示的选项。一般需要设置为「nodownload」,禁止用户下载视频。

除了上述属性之外,还有一些事件可以通过JavaScript来监听视频播放的过程。比如可以监听视频播放的开始、暂停、结束等事件,对视频进行更灵活的控制。

需要注意的是,虽然HTML5视频标签具备良好的兼容性,但不同浏览器对视频格式的支持有所不同。为了确保兼容性,开发人员应尽可能地使用经典的和主流的视频格式(比如MP4),并将其他格式的备选项作为source标签的子元素提供。

总的来说,HTML5视频标签是一个灵活、易用且功能强大的元素,可以帮助我们在网页中优雅地嵌入视频来丰富内容和吸引用户。

壹涵网络我们是一家专注于网站建设、企业营销、网站关键词排名、AI内容生成、新媒体营销和短视频营销等业务的公司。我们拥有一支优秀的团队,专门致力于为客户提供优质的服务。

我们致力于为客户提供一站式的互联网营销服务,帮助客户在激烈的市场竞争中获得更大的优势和发展机会!

点赞(62) 打赏

评论列表 共有 0 条评论

暂无评论
立即
投稿
发表
评论
返回
顶部